A narcissist may choose to scrub all their information from public platforms like Google, Facebook, and other social media for various reasons, most of which are tied to their desire to control their image, avoid accountability, and maintain a sense of power and superiority. Here are some potential reasons why a narcissist might engage in such behavior:
Reinventing Their Image: Narcissists are highly concerned about how they are perceived by others. If they feel that their online presence doesn't align with the image they want to project or if they fear that certain information might expose their vulnerabilities or flaws, they may scrub their profiles to create a new and more favorable online persona.
Avoiding Exposure: Narcissists often have a hidden agenda and might engage in manipulative behaviors or actions that they don't want others to discover. By removing personal information from public platforms, they reduce the risk of people finding out about their less desirable actions or past behavior.
Control and Privacy: Narcissists value control over every aspect of their lives, including how much information others have access to about them. Scrubbing their online presence allows them to keep a tighter grip on their personal information and maintain a sense of privacy.
Fear of Criticism: Narcissists have a fragile ego and may struggle to handle criticism or negative feedback from others. By removing themselves from public platforms, they can avoid potential criticism and maintain the illusion of being flawless.
Discarding the Past: A narcissist might want to sever ties with past relationships, associations, or memories that they find inconvenient or that don't fit their current narrative of success and superiority. Deleting their online presence is a way to cut ties with their past.
Eliminating Evidence: If a narcissist has engaged in manipulative or harmful behavior and fears that evidence of such behavior might be used against them, they may attempt to remove any traces of it from public platforms.
Maintaining Power and Control: By controlling what information is available about them online, narcissists can retain power over their narrative and manipulate how others perceive them, thus maintaining their sense of control and dominance.
It's essential to understand that these actions are driven by the narcissist's underlying psychological tendencies and their need to protect their self-image. Scrubbing their online presence doesn't change the fact that they have narcissistic traits or that their behavior may negatively impact those around them.
